1. Incorporate Spanish-impressed architectural aspects and design options
Although there are no rigid guidelines for reaching this aesthetic, there are certain qualities that are normally observed in Spanish-design and style residences.
“Install arched details and doorways to recreate an old-planet Spanish architectural vibe,” endorses Rachel Moriarty Interiors. “Incorporate hand-painted tiles in a patterned structure and terracotta flooring for an genuine Spanish Hacienda really feel. Use earthy colors like terracotta and mustard to build a warm and inviting ambiance that mimics the Spanish Hacienda appear.
Use iron accents these as stair rails, lights, and components to recreate Spanish architectural style.”

8. Embrace imperfections when styling your house
In Spanish interior layout, there is a celebration of the attractiveness identified in weathered textures and worn surfaces. Instead of striving for flawless perfection, enable imperfections to shine by means of, telling a story of the passage of time and introducing a feeling of authenticity.
“Historically, Spanish Haciendas ended up created employing standard supplies these as crimson clay, stucco, and rustic woods that were each productive and natural to the environment. The beauty of these houses, specially in the interiors, comes from their imperfections,” shares Natalie Aldridge, Inside Designer and Contributing Editor for The Glam Pad .
“Practically nothing is as well treasured or far too refined. Incorporating a comparable mentality when doing the job to achieve this type is crucial. A exceptional present day reference to Spanish Hacienda fashion can be observed in the Mediterranean-inspired homes of Palm Beach, made by the legendary Addison Mizner. Despite getting American interpretations of a historic type, they exude remarkable magnificence and authenticity.”
9. Harmonize earthy colors and natural components
By thoughtfully mixing warm colours and purely natural products, you can infuse your house with the distinctive essence of Hacienda design.
“The foundation of a Spanish Hacienda-fashion interior lies in its earthy colour palette and the use of reliable supplies. Commence by picking out warm, earth-toned hues these as terracotta, mustard yellows, or sandy beige for your partitions. These colors reflect the sunlight-soaked landscapes of Spain and create a cozy ambiance. For a additional neutral and contemporary technique, use creamy warm white or sandy beige tones for your walls or cabinets,” endorses Stephanie Georgoulakis, President of Existence by Structure Interiors.
“To infuse your room with authenticity, incorporate purely natural and rustic products throughout. Exposed wooden beams, stone walls, and conventional terracotta tiles provide as distinctive architectural components. Embrace their uncooked splendor and let them to take middle phase in your design and style. Use reclaimed wooden for furniture, flooring, or accent items to maintain a feeling of heritage and craftsmanship. Pair these elements with wrought iron fixtures and lights to include a touch of elegance and make a cohesive Spanish Hacienda ambiance.”
